To answer this question, about what would make a thread disappear, hear are some reminders from the BST Guidelines:
Quote:
Originally Posted by jbalcer
How to post your items When posting your items that you wish to buy, sell, or trade, follow these instructions:
First, select the appropriate forum for your item/s. ISO if you're looking to buy a particular item, Buy/Sell to list item/s for sale or sale and trade, or Trade to trade your item/s with someone else.
To create your listing, look for the button that says New Thread.
List all of your items in a single forum post. Don't create separate posts for each item.
Update your original post as needed to reflect those items sold or traded (look for the Edit button on the right hand side of your original post).
Create only 1 post either in the Buy/Sell or the Trade forums. Please do not post in both forums.
Quote:
Originally Posted by jbalcer
B/S/T Forum Organization
To keep searches productive and postings current, listed threads will be deleted after one month (28 days). Please make sure you have all your contact information saved.
Threads are deleted after they have run for 4 weeks. Please make sure your information is saved.

I have seen some people post pictures on their sell page.
How are they doing this?
I have TAC sets to sell and many people keep asking me to see pictures, I was wondering how to post them right to the sell list.
Thanks,
Nancy
stampinwithnan: if you go to edit your ad scroll down to the bottom of the page and there should be a box that says manage attachments, if you click on that a box will come up and you can choose a pic from your album, hit open and then upload, they will come up at the bottom of your thread as thumbnail attachments, you can add three pics to each thread. Hope this helps...
